Output d143f66e554acef7b00dcd8f4e2c720d08e1277c619c13d5e8a4a0bf10aea3ca:0

value
2880154
script pubkey
OP_0 OP_PUSHBYTES_20 dfdd342d8bf4ee3fef3802e967e6cd8a18f8fa8e
address
bc1qmlwngtvt7nhrlmecqt5k0ekd3gv0375w4taj7y
transaction
d143f66e554acef7b00dcd8f4e2c720d08e1277c619c13d5e8a4a0bf10aea3ca
spent
true